The Artisan's Buying Guide
Finding the right crafting kit is an art form in itself. Whether you are searching for mess-free activities for toddlers, STEM-based electronics kits for tweens, or professional-grade acrylics for yourself, consider the following:
- Age Appropriateness: Always check the manufacturer's recommended age. Kits like Snap Circuits require fine motor skills, while Washable Finger Paints are perfect for ages 2+.
- Mess Factor: Look for "Air Dry," "Washable," or "Water-based" if you prefer an easy cleanup. Foil art and scratch paper are excellent low-mess alternatives.
- Educational Value: Projects that combine art with science (STEM/STEAM) provide hours of engaging, brain-building play.
